Output f75222c76e9e62f6a5cc9d6ae6dffee926efb5832520466c0eb84de941a6850e:0

value
35288110
script pubkey
OP_0 OP_PUSHBYTES_20 e8da5a66fb793bfd45f0961875540650c10c454a
address
bc1qard95ehm0yal630sjcv824qx2rqsc322xtxmj8
transaction
f75222c76e9e62f6a5cc9d6ae6dffee926efb5832520466c0eb84de941a6850e
spent
true